桩基础工程具有较强的隐蔽性,在各种因素影响下易产生质量问题,进而降低建筑的耐久性和稳定性,因此,需做好桩基的检测工作.文中以某高层建筑桩基工程为例,通过对比分析低应变检测法与声波透射检测法在桩基检测中的具体应用,及时发现内部缺陷,并采取相应措施,以减少安全风险和隐患.

Pile foundation engineering has strong concealment,which is easy to produce quality problems under the influence of various fac-tors,and then reduce the durability and stability of the building.Therefore,it is necessary to do a good job in the detection of pile foundation.In this paper,taking a high-rise building pile foundation project as an example,the application of low strain detection method and acoustic transmission detection method in pile foundation detection is compared and analyzed,and internal defects are found in time and corresponding measures are taken to reduce safety risks and hidden dangers.
